  3. Five Points (Columbia, South Carolina) -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Five_Points_(Columbia...

    Five Points in Columbia, South Carolina is a shopping, restaurant, and nightlife area that attracts customers from the nearby University of South Carolina and the Columbia metropolitan area. It is the center for the city's annual St. Patrick’s Day Festival. [1]

  8. Dock Street Theatre -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Dock_Street_Theatre

    The Historic Dock Street Theatre reopened for the third time on March 18, 2010 after a three-year, $19 million renovation by the City of Charleston. This extensive full-scale renovation brought the historic theatre into the 21st century with state-of-the-art lighting and sound, modern heating and air conditioning, and new restrooms and seating.
